ANIN J.A.: ANIN J.A. delivered the ruling of the court. This is an application by the applicant company for the grant of an order staying proceedings of the respondent committee pending the hearing and determination of the appeal hererin filed on 5 December 1975.

In support of the application Mr. Reindorf, learned counsel, relied on the affidavit sworn in support of the application by one Mr. Ole Erichsen, the applicant company’s director and executive, sworn to and filed on 5 December 1975, together with the accompanying exhibits. He has urged before us that unless the proceedings “actively going on” before the respondent committee are stayed, the applicant company will be prejudiced and the committee would have accomplished what they are now being sought to be restrained from doing.
